Wild at Heart: Gustav Sonntag opens an emotional painting journey at the Art Temple

With Wild at Heart, the Art Temple Kassel showcases a solo exhibition by Gustav Sonntag from May 23 to June 21, 2026, transforming urban life into large-format, compelling paintings. The exhibition unfolds across three floors, leading the audience through visual spaces between ecstasy and disillusionment, between hope, addiction, obsession, and failure. Admission is free. Large-format painting as immediate art experience

Sonntag's works emphasize presence: strong color tensions, dense compositions, and cinematic sequences define the exhibition atmosphere. The scenes of urban everyday life appear raw yet poetic. They condense a painting that does not explain but sharpens perception and keeps interpretation open. Three floors, three moods, a narrative pull

The ground floor is dominated by richness of detail and painterly virtuosity. In the basement, the impact darkens to almost dizzying intensity. The upper floor opens up calmer, reflective moments with a sense of transcendence and lightness. This spatial dramaturgy makes the tour itself part of the work's observation. An artist between the New Leipzig School and his own style

Gustav Sonntag, born in Berlin in 1994, studied painting and graphics at the University of Graphic and Book Arts Leipzig and graduated in 2022; in 2024, he began a postgraduate study at the Karlsruhe Academy of Art with Tatjana Doll. His works have already been shown in institutional exhibitions, galleries, and art fairs, including in Leipzig, Kiel, Potsdam, and Assen. He received the Eb-Dietzsch Art Prize and was nominated for the STRABAG Art Award. ([gustavsonntag.de](https://www.gustavsonntag.de/))
